NEW STEP BY STEP MAP FOR WHAT IS MD5 TECHNOLOGY

New Step by Step Map For what is md5 technology

New Step by Step Map For what is md5 technology

Blog Article

A important enter is really a pseudorandom little bit generator that creates a stream eight-bit variety that's unpredictable without the need of expertise in the input vital, The output in the generator is called essential-stream, and is particularly blended one byte in a ti

It had been formulated by Ronald Rivest in 1991 and is mostly accustomed to validate data integrity. Nonetheless, as a consequence of its vulnerability to various attacks, MD5 is now deemed insecure and has actually been mainly changed by more robust hashing algorithms like SHA-256.

The primary line, “Hash place = Input Benefit % Desk Dimension”, simply lays out the components for The straightforward modulo hash perform. This operation is likewise typically created as h (k) = k mod m, where:

The MD5 algorithm analyses incoming information and produces a hard and fast-dimensions hash price. Now that we’ve discussed what is MD5 hash, Enable’s evaluate How can MD5 performs:

ZDNet stories in excess of twenty five per cent of the main CMS methods make use of the old and out-of-date MD5 hashing plan since the default for securing and storing person passwords.

Collision Resistance: MD5 was originally collision-resistant, as two independent inputs that provide precisely the same hash price needs to be computationally not possible. In practice, having said that, vulnerabilities that empower collision assaults are uncovered.

MD5 is usually used click here in digital signatures. Much like how a physical signature verifies the authenticity of a document, a digital signature verifies the authenticity of digital knowledge.

A hash collision happens when two different inputs make precisely the same hash value, or output. The safety and encryption of a hash algorithm rely upon producing exceptional hash values, and collisions depict stability vulnerabilities that can be exploited.

MD5, after a greatly trustworthy cryptographic hash purpose, has become regarded as insecure resulting from substantial vulnerabilities that undermine its efficiency in stability-delicate applications. The principal challenge with MD5 is its susceptibility to collision assaults, where two distinct inputs can make a similar hash value.

MD5 has long been greatly applied for quite some time resulting from various noteworthy rewards, notably in situations exactly where speed and simplicity are key considerations. They involve:

The MD5 hash purpose’s safety is thought to be seriously compromised. Collisions are available inside of seconds, and they can be useful for destructive functions. In fact, in 2012, the Flame spy ware that infiltrated 1000s of computer systems and devices in Iran was viewed as one of several most troublesome security problems with the yr.

e. path may well alter continually and site visitors is dynamic. So, static TOT can't be employed at TCP. And unnecessarily retransmitting the exact same info packet various instances may perhaps result in congestion. Alternative for this i

SHA-one can nonetheless be accustomed to confirm aged time stamps and digital signatures, nevertheless the NIST (Nationwide Institute of Benchmarks and Technology) does not suggest employing SHA-one to generate digital signatures or in situations wherever collision resistance is required.

In 1996, collisions were being found in the compression perform of MD5, and Hans Dobbertin wrote while in the RSA Laboratories complex e-newsletter, "The introduced assault would not yet threaten sensible programs of MD5, nevertheless it arrives relatively near .

Report this page